question how do you replace footwell bulb? Asin do you twist it out or pull it out and can I remove it while the light is still on when the door is open because I can't get down to it otherwise and also the main interior light at top of your head how do I go around replacing that what is the size of led bulb? And twist or pull to remove them? rather ask then go ahead and brake something mk7.5 model

Link to comment
Share on other sites


The foot well ones are a simple friction fit, you just push them in. You can remove and fit them when they are on (and as LED's only work one way it helps to do so) but the "old" filament bulbs can be hot so you may need gloves or at least pull them out when off. Sit in the seat and reach forward when the door closed and you should find them easy enough to pull out, then open the door, and use a torch to put the replacements in.

Sorry Chris. I relied to a previous post on page 1, without realising that there was a page 2.

Anyway, yes the bulb holder does just push in. The problem is getting them out, they have 4 claws which when pushed in to the hole grip the rim. To get them out, apart from the access problem means that you have to push the grip in on at least 2 legs, or be brutal if you can grip the holder to force 2 legs to compress thereby leaving the other 2 to be pulled out at an angle.
